“Sacred Cow” Hamburgers -- I’m Lovin’ It
5/29/2011 12:38:14 PM
On the physical level, Jeet Kune Do deals with the science of unarmed combat. It was designed, in part, to kill a lot of “sacred cows” of myth, dogma, and tradition that had existed in the martial arts world for centuries. This was not done out of malice, but rather to clear away the clouds of misperception, eradicate the many fallacies concerning martial arts, and help people understand what martial art training was really about.
